Ashley Lodge Bed & Breakfast

Ashley Lodge Bed & Breakfast is a 4-star stay in Ireland, tucked in the town of Wexford and just 6.9mi from the city center. The address is Ballycowan Tagoat. With 331 reviews, this B&B has a well-trodden history of guest impressions.

Featured amenities include free on-site parking, free WiFi, and non-smoking rooms. Guests can enjoy a tranquil garden and a playground, plus horseback riding and a nearby golf course available for an extra charge.

Nestled at Ballycowan Tagoat, this countryside hideaway offers easy access to the sights around Wexford and the Irish coast, making it a fun base for exploring the region.

Two room types are listed: Room - 2 Bed (accommodates 2 adults and 1 child; non-smoking) and Standard Room (accommodates 2 adults and 1 child; non-smoking). Cash is the only accepted payment option, keeping things straightforward for guests during their stay.
